    Bonus Bait is a compilation album by British musician and DJ Andrew "Mr. Scruff" Carthy. It was released on 9 February 2009 by Ninja Tune, and features outtakes of his album Ninja Tuna. In the United States, an MP3 double-album version of Ninja Tuna was released on 17 February, which included Bonus Bait as the second album. Track listing

    Artwork

    Mr. Scruff's album and single cover art, music videos, merchandise and his official website are noted for their whimsical cartoonish look; the cartoons are drawn by Mr. Scruff himself in what he calls "potato style." The images and animations are also projected onto large screens during his gigs.Scruff also drew cartoons for music magazines such as Jockey Slutin the 1990s.

    Tea

    Mr. Scruff began selling tea from a small room at the Manchester club, the Music Box (where he was resident DJ around 2000), with the proceeds going to charity. When he started touring, Mr. Scruff took the enterprise with him and gained a reputation for being the DJ with the teashop. When appearing at festivals, such as Big Chill and WOMAD, tea stalls or tents were erected and were open for the duration of the festivals.     Fish

    Most of Mr. Scruff's studio albums contain tracks about fish, whales and other sea-life, which cut up recordings of voiceovers from children's stories and nature documentaries to create surreal and silly stories. They began with the track "Sea Mammal" (featuring a sample from Boogie Down Productions' track "Part Time Sucker"), released on the single "Hocus Pocus" (1995).     The last segment from the documentary movie Scratch(2001), entitled "Full Circle," features a different mix of "Spandex Man" with additional samples.
    The opening scene of the Malcolm in the Middle episode "Evacuation" features "Blackpool Roll".
    Episodes of the Channel 4 TV comedy show Spaced featured the tracks "Spandex Man," "Chipmunk" and "Blackpool Roll" from the Keep It Unrealalbum.
    "Spandex Man" was also used on the BBC series Top Gear, is often used on the BBC Three show The Real Hustle and features in the films SW9 and Gumball Rally 3000.
